Jean-Marie Bouzereau - Meursault 2023
“A Meursault that perfectly captures the essence of its terroir: round and deliciously aromatic!”
The latest addition to Jean-Marie Bouzereau’s Meursault lineup is yet another golden, full-bodied gem. A perfect embodiment of its appellation, it opens with a zesty, subtly oaky nose: fresh vanilla bean intertwines with brioche notes. On the palate, it unfolds with freshness and roundness, featuring flavors of stone fruit, acacia honey, and toasted hazelnuts. It pairs perfectly with a meal featuring white fish or deliciously briny seafood.

About the estate:
Jean-Marie Bouzereau settled on part of the family estate in 1994 and now manages a 9-hectare vineyard. A trusted name in the Meursault appellation, he also produces wines in Puligny, Volnay, Pommard, and Beaune.
